Drumbeat
The recording of the Drumbeat album at Abbey Road Studios. 
Pictured, from the left, are: John Barry, Sylvia Sands, Stewart Morris, Dennis Lotis, 
Norman Newell, Bob Miller, Geoff Love.

25th April:

Taking part:

Orchestra Director: Bob Miller
Orchestra: The Millermen
Group Leader: John Barry
Instrumental Group: The John Barry Seven
Vocal Group: The Three Lana Sisters
Vocal Group: The Raindrops
Vocal Group: The Mudlarks
Vocalist: Vince Eager
Vocalist/Pianist: Roy Young
Vocalist: Sylvia Sands
Vocalist Adam Faith
Vocalist Terry Dene
Guest Vocalist: Anthony Newley
Compere: Gus Goodwin

 

Music played 'live':

 

Vince Eager & JB7: Ready Teddy
Lana Sisters & Millermen: Buzzin
Adam Faith & JB7: Never Mind
Millermen: Robot Walk
Roy Young & JB7: Where were you on our wedding day?
Raindrops & Millermen: Charlie Brown
John Barry Seven: Farrago
Sylvia Sands, Millermen: Love me in the daytime
Terry Dene & JB7: I need your love tonight
Vince Eager, Raindrops, Millermen: Never Be Anyone Else But You
Millermen: Peter Gunn
Roy Young & JB7: I Go Ape
Anthony Newley, Raindrops, Millermen: Idle On Parade
John Barry Seven: Bees Knees
Mudlarks & Millermen: Tell Him No
Adam Faith & JB7: I Vibrate
Vince Eager & Company: Open Up Dem Pearly Gates
